目錄
- 1 版本控制
版本控制
編輯版本控制(英語:Version control)是維護工程藍圖的標準作法,能追蹤工程藍圖從誕生一直到定案的過程。此外,版本控制也是一種軟件工程技巧,借此能在軟件開發的過程中,確保由不同人所編輯的同一程序文件都得到同步。
最簡單的版本控制就是保留軟件不同版本的數份copy,并且適當編號。許多大型開發案都是使用這種簡單技巧。雖然這種方法能用,但是很沒效率。一是因為保存的數份copy幾乎完全一樣,也因為這種方法要高度依靠開發者的自我紀律,而常導致錯誤。因此,有人開發出了將部分或全部版本控制工作自動化的版本控制系統。
大部分的軟件開發案,會有好幾個開發人員同時工作。如果兩個人員同時要改變同一個文件,而沒有管理訪問權限,很可能會改寫彼此的工作。
所以權限管理控制系統會在兩種方法中擇一解決:采用中央式系統,由中央權威管理訪問權限;或是像分布式系統容許多個單位同時進行,包括同時更動同一文件。
內容由匿名用戶提供,本內容不代表www.gelinmeiz.com立場,內容投訴舉報請聯系www.gelinmeiz.com客服。如若轉載,請注明出處:http://www.gelinmeiz.com/101886/